Electric Vehicles: The Rise of EVs in the Automotive Industry

The rise of electric vehicles (EVs) in the automotive industry is undoubtedly one of the most exciting and impactful trends of our time. EVs have gained significant traction in recent years, with major automakers investing heavily in their development. The push towards electric mobility is driven by several factors, including environmental concerns, government regulations, and advancements in battery technology.

One of the main advantages of EVs is their reduced carbon footprint. By eliminating the need for gasoline or diesel, electric vehicles help reduce greenhouse gas emissions and combat climate change. Additionally, EVs offer lower operating costs and can provide a smoother and quieter ride compared to traditional internal combustion engine vehicles.

As the demand for EVs continues to grow, automakers are investing in the development of charging infrastructure to alleviate concerns about range anxiety. The availability of public charging stations is expanding, and advancements in fast-charging technology are reducing charging times significantly.

Moreover, the growing adoption of EVs has led to increased investment in research and development, resulting in innovative designs and improved battery technology. These advancements are making electric vehicles more affordable, efficient, and accessible to a wider range of consumers.

Autonomous Vehicles: The Road to Self-Driving Cars

Autonomous vehicles, also known as self-driving cars, have long been the stuff of science fiction. However, recent advancements in technology have brought us closer than ever to a future where our cars can drive themselves. The road to self-driving cars is filled with challenges, but it also presents immense opportunities for innovation and transformation.

One of the main benefits of autonomous vehicles is the potential for increased safety on the roads. With advanced sensors, cameras, and artificial intelligence, self-driving cars can analyze their surroundings and make split-second decisions to avoid accidents. This could significantly reduce human error, which is a leading cause of car accidents.

Autonomous vehicles also have the potential to improve traffic flow and reduce congestion. With the ability to communicate with each other and optimize their routes, self-driving cars can create a more efficient and streamlined transportation system.

However, there are still many obstacles to overcome before autonomous vehicles become a common sight on our roads. Legal and regulatory frameworks need to be established to ensure the safe and responsible deployment of self-driving cars. Additionally, public acceptance and trust in the technology are crucial for its widespread adoption.

 

Connectivity: The Role of Technology in Vehicles

Connectivity is revolutionizing the automotive industry, with technology playing a pivotal role in enhancing the driving experience. From advanced infotainment systems to integrated navigation and connectivity services, vehicles are becoming more connected than ever before.

With the rise of smart devices, the integration of technology in vehicles has become essential. Connectivity allows drivers to stay connected to their digital lives, with features like hands-free calling, voice recognition, and smartphone integration. Additionally, with the advent of 5G technology, vehicles will be able to provide faster and more reliable internet connectivity, enabling real-time updates and access to a wide range of digital services.

Connectivity also plays a vital role in improving safety on the roads. Features like adv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) use connectivity to communicate with other vehicles, pedestrians, and traffic infrastructure to enhance situational awareness and prevent accidents. Connected vehicles can receive real-time traffic information and alerts, enabling drivers to make more informed decisions and avoid congestion or hazardous conditions.

Furthermore, connectivity allows for remote vehicle diagnostics and over-the-air software updates. This means that automakers can remotely monitor vehicle performance, identify potential issues, and provide software updates to enhance functionality, safety, and performance.

Sustainability: The Need for Green Automotive Solutions

As the world becomes increasingly aware of the environmental impact of traditional gasoline and diesel vehicles, there is a growing need for green automotive solutions. Sustainability is no longer just a buzzword; it's a necessity for the future of the automotive industry.

The need for green automotive solutions is driven by several factors. Firstly, there is a global push to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and combat climate change. Gasoline and diesel vehicles contribute significantly to air pollution and carbon emissions, making the adoption of green alternatives imperative.

Secondly, government regulations are becoming stricter, with many countries announcing plans to ban the sale of new internal combustion engine vehicles in the near future. This is forcing automakers to shift their focus towards developing electric and hybrid vehicles.

Additionally, advancements in battery technology are making electric vehicles more efficient and affordable. As battery prices continue to decrease, the adoption of electric vehicles is becoming more accessible to a wider range of consumers.

Green automotive solutions also extend beyond electric vehicles. The use of alternative fuels, such as hydrogen and biofuels, can further reduce emissions and reliance on fossil fuels.

Design and Functionality: Innovations in Vehicle Features

In the rapidly evolving automotive industry, design and functionality play a crucial role in attracting consumers. Automakers are continuously innovating and introducing new features that enhance the driving experience and provide added convenience.

One of the key areas of innovation is in the field of vehicle connectivity. Today's vehicles come equipped with advanced infotainment systems that offer seamless integration with smartphones and other smart devices. This allows drivers to access their favorite apps, make hands-free calls, and even control certain vehicle functions with voice commands. Additionally, integrated navigation systems provide real-time traffic updates and suggest alternative routes to avoid congestion.

Another area of focus is in-car entertainment. Automakers are incorporating high-quality audio systems, larger touchscreen displays, and rear-seat entertainment options to ensure that passengers enjoy a comfortable and enjoyable ride. Features like wireless charging pads and multiple USB ports make it easy to keep devices powered up and connected.

In terms of functionality, automakers are introducing innovative safety features that enhance the overall driving experience. This includes features like ad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, automatic emergency braking, and blind-spot monitoring. These technologies not only improve safety but also make driving more convenient and less stressful.

When it comes to design, automakers are experimenting with sleek and aerodynamic exteriors that not only look stylish but also improve fuel efficiency. Inside the cabin, attention is given to ergonomic designs and comfortable seating options that provide maximum comfort for long journeys.
